According to him, the machine in the machine contains an 8.8 -inch OLED display that is allegedly made by the Samsung display. This will improve the predecessor, which features the IPSLCD screen.
The prototype also includes a Z2 processor and a 780 -meter graphics card, which is most likely out of date as a more powerful AMD 890M card is expected.
In the video, they show the device in a game and some system settings. It seems to have 1TB SSD storage and 32GB of RAM, double the original Legion Go.
It looks like the battery will be better. The current Go Console has 49.2WHR battery, which lasted barely two hours in our test. The new battery is roaming on 74Whr, so we may come up with Go 2 for three hours, but hopefully Lenovo has also worked on power performance and correction.
